Transaction 2389776a3e829a4dce84d81c37123805d7c3a4fde91b651b667eeec8a893f781
1 Input
-
758363cdbf4f1cac52983acb49ebd853a80611f3db90b32439cdc0e0eb236ea3:0
OP_DATA_48(48) 44022065817b38949a14ed8ac5c4532d86621b6812bfa1a2b64f15c653d507d5bd5573022066581b543c5a9e1db2cf5d
1 Outputs
- 2389776a3e829a4dce84d81c37123805d7c3a4fde91b651b667eeec8a893f781:0
value 57700
address 2N5d1xbFifkedQVuu2tv3voxAKRVzNjn9uC